-
Notifications
You must be signed in to change notification settings - Fork 9.2k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
r/s3_bucket: read-only request_payer
argument
#22613
Conversation
request_payer
argumentrequest_payer
argument
1e894e8
to
6623846
Compare
ffeacc8
to
dfd36ba
Compare
44a00a8
to
5ac8e8c
Compare
d18912d
to
32a3c99
Compare
733af0e
to
42b449e
Compare
Optionally preceded by #22649 |
@@ -397,42 +397,6 @@ func TestAccS3Bucket_Basic_acceleration(t *testing.T) { | |||
}) | |||
} | |||
|
|||
func TestAccS3Bucket_Basic_requestPayer(t *testing.T) { |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Tests have been ported over to #22649
42b449e
to
95c6e7b
Compare
95c6e7b
to
5ff8e43
Compare
18688a6
to
322647c
Compare
d53bd70
to
890b3a3
Compare
890b3a3
to
aa299da
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ks great! 🎉
% make testacc TESTS=TestAccS3Bucket PKG=s3
==> Checking that code complies with gofmt requirements...
TF_ACC=1 go test ./internal/service/s3/... -v -count 1 -parallel 20 -run='TestAccS3Bucket' -timeout 180m
--- SKIP: TestAccS3BucketReplicationConfiguration_existingObjectReplication (0.00s)
--- PASS: TestAccS3Bucket_Basic_forceDestroyWithEmptyPrefixes (67.07s)
--- PASS: TestAccS3Bucket_Basic_forceDestroy (73.59s)
--- PASS: TestAccS3BucketNotification_eventbridge (81.59s)
--- PASS: TestAccS3BucketAnalyticsConfiguration_basic (84.24s)
--- PASS: TestAccS3BucketVersioning_disappears (85.57s)
--- PASS: TestAccS3BucketCorsConfiguration_MultipleRules (86.39s)
--- PASS: TestAccS3Bucket_Basic_forceDestroyWithObjectLockEnabled (88.09s)
--- PASS: TestAccS3BucketVersioning_basic (96.68s)
--- PASS: TestAccS3BucketVersioning_MFADelete (99.00s)
--- PASS: TestAccS3Bucket_Replication_expectVersioningValidationError (30.31s)
--- PASS: TestAccS3Bucket_Manage_objectLock (142.34s)
--- PASS: TestAccS3BucketReplicationConfiguration_disappears (77.28s)
--- PASS: TestAccS3Bucket_Replication_schemaV2SameRegion (101.71s)
--- PASS: TestAccS3Bucket_Replication_withoutPrefix (105.16s)
--- PASS: TestAccS3BucketPolicy_basic (66.72s)
--- PASS: TestAccS3BucketVersioning_update (200.92s)
--- PASS: TestAccS3BucketReplicationConfiguration_schemaV2SameRegion (205.07s)
--- PASS: TestAccS3BucketOwnershipControls_Disappears_bucket (37.79s)
--- PASS: TestAccS3Bucket_Replication_withoutStorageClass (93.33s)
--- PASS: TestAccS3BucketOwnershipControls_disappears (48.33s)
--- PASS: TestAccS3BucketOwnershipControls_basic (56.50s)
--- PASS: TestAccS3BucketOwnershipControls_Rule_objectOwnership (107.89s)
--- PASS: TestAccS3BucketNotification_Topic_multiple (57.70s)
--- PASS: TestAccS3BucketNotification_topic (56.83s)
--- PASS: TestAccS3Bucket_Replication_RTC_valid (311.64s)
--- PASS: TestAccS3Bucket_Replication_ruleDestinationAddAccessControlTranslation (139.06s)
--- PASS: TestAccS3Bucket_Replication_twoDestination (72.01s)
--- PASS: TestAccS3Bucket_Replication_ruleDestinationAccessControlTranslation (143.17s)
--- PASS: TestAccS3BucketPolicy_policyUpdate (72.43s)
--- PASS: TestAccS3BucketReplicationConfiguration_schemaV2DestinationMetrics (346.99s)
--- PASS: TestAccS3BucketReplicationConfiguration_withoutStorageClass (347.29s)
--- PASS: TestAccS3BucketReplicationConfiguration_replicationTimeControl (347.53s)
--- PASS: TestAccS3BucketReplicationConfiguration_schemaV2 (348.01s)
--- PASS: TestAccS3BucketReplicationConfiguration_replicaModifications (348.87s)
--- PASS: TestAccS3BucketNotification_update (132.17s)
--- PASS: TestAccS3Bucket_Replication_multipleDestinationsNonEmptyFilter (69.74s)
--- PASS: TestAccS3Bucket_Manage_lifecycleRuleExpirationEmptyBlock (48.13s)
--- PASS: TestAccS3BucketReplicationConfiguration_twoDestination (331.20s)
--- PASS: TestAccS3Bucket_Manage_lifecycleRuleAbortIncompleteMultipartUploadDaysNoExpiration (57.08s)
--- PASS: TestAccS3BucketReplicationConfiguration_multipleDestinationsNonEmptyFilter (336.40s)
--- PASS: TestAccS3BucketReplicationConfiguration_multipleDestinationsEmptyFilter (330.15s)
--- PASS: TestAccS3Bucket_Security_logging (66.94s)
--- PASS: TestAccS3Bucket_Replication_multipleDestinationsEmptyFilter (84.08s)
--- PASS: TestAccS3BucketReplicationConfiguration_configurationRuleDestinationAddAccessControlTranslation (419.87s)
--- PASS: TestAccS3BucketPublicAccessBlock_restrictPublicBuckets (126.91s)
--- PASS: TestAccS3BucketReplicationConfiguration_configurationRuleDestinationAccessControlTranslation (421.95s)
--- PASS: TestAccS3Bucket_Security_corsEmptyOrigin (67.28s)
--- PASS: TestAccS3Bucket_Security_corsDelete (56.22s)
--- PASS: TestAccS3BucketPublicAccessBlock_ignorePublicACLs (136.96s)
--- PASS: TestAccS3BucketNotification_queue (99.04s)
--- PASS: TestAccS3Bucket_Replication_schemaV2 (362.14s)
--- PASS: TestAccS3Bucket_Basic_shouldFailNotFound (47.34s)
--- PASS: TestAccS3Bucket_Manage_lifecycleExpireMarkerOnly (117.51s)
--- PASS: TestAccS3BucketPublicAccessBlock_blockPublicPolicy (144.17s)
--- PASS: TestAccS3Bucket_Manage_versioningAndMfaDeleteDisabled (68.53s)
--- PASS: TestAccS3Bucket_Manage_MfaDeleteDisabled (67.56s)
--- PASS: TestAccS3Bucket_Manage_versioningDisabled (71.54s)
--- PASS: TestAccS3BucketCorsConfiguration_SingleRule (67.56s)
--- PASS: TestAccS3Bucket_Basic_keyEnabled (84.11s)
--- PASS: TestAccS3BucketCorsConfiguration_disappears (62.19s)
--- PASS: TestAccS3BucketAnalyticsConfiguration_WithStorageClassAnalysis_empty (4.52s)
--- PASS: TestAccS3Bucket_Security_enableDefaultEncryptionWhenAES256IsUsed (69.39s)
--- PASS: TestAccS3BucketCorsConfiguration_basic (71.06s)
--- PASS: TestAccS3BucketPublicAccessBlock_Disappears_bucket (50.38s)
--- PASS: TestAccS3BucketReplicationConfiguration_basic (425.18s)
--- PASS: TestAccS3Bucket_Security_corsUpdate (131.74s)
--- PASS: TestAccS3Bucket_Manage_lifecycleBasic (179.65s)
--- PASS: TestAccS3Bucket_Security_enableDefaultEncryptionWhenTypical (82.52s)
--- PASS: TestAccS3BucketAnalyticsConfiguration_WithStorageClassAnalysis_full (71.35s)
--- PASS: TestAccS3BucketPublicAccessBlock_disappears (61.07s)
--- PASS: TestAccS3BucketAnalyticsConfiguration_WithFilter_remove (128.33s)
--- PASS: TestAccS3BucketAnalyticsConfiguration_WithFilter_empty (3.01s)
--- PASS: TestAccS3Bucket_Security_disableDefaultEncryptionWhenDefaultEncryptionIsEnabled (135.22s)
--- PASS: TestAccS3BucketAnalyticsConfiguration_WithStorageClassAnalysis_default (72.94s)
--- PASS: TestAccS3Bucket_Manage_versioning (149.68s)
--- PASS: TestAccS3BucketNotification_lambdaFunction (45.12s)
--- PASS: TestAccS3BucketPublicAccessBlock_basic (70.94s)
--- PASS: TestAccS3Bucket_Web_routingRules (134.42s)
--- PASS: TestAccS3BucketNotification_LambdaFunctionLambdaFunctionARN_alias (84.53s)
--- PASS: TestAccS3BucketCorsConfiguration_update (176.19s)
--- PASS: TestAccS3BucketAnalyticsConfiguration_WithFilter_prefixAndTags (124.50s)
--- PASS: TestAccS3BucketAnalyticsConfiguration_WithFilter_prefix (125.27s)
--- PASS: TestAccS3Bucket_Tags_basic (77.65s)
--- PASS: TestAccS3BucketAnalyticsConfiguration_WithFilter_multipleTags (126.00s)
--- PASS: TestAccS3Bucket_Basic_emptyString (78.33s)
--- PASS: TestAccS3BucketPublicAccessBlock_blockPublicACLs (184.96s)
--- PASS: TestAccS3BucketAnalyticsConfiguration_removed (105.07s)
--- PASS: TestAccS3BucketAnalyticsConfiguration_WithFilter_singleTag (123.56s)
--- PASS: TestAccS3Bucket_Replication_basic (328.63s)
--- PASS: TestAccS3Bucket_Web_redirect (201.56s)
--- PASS: TestAccS3Bucket_Tags_ignoreTags (47.73s)
--- PASS: TestAccS3Bucket_Web_simple (189.12s)
--- PASS: TestAccS3Bucket_Basic_generatedName (73.18s)
--- PASS: TestAccS3Bucket_Security_aclToGrant (117.82s)
--- PASS: TestAccS3BucketIntelligentTieringConfiguration_disappears (54.45s)
--- PASS: TestAccS3BucketPolicy_IAMRoleOrder_policyDoc (184.76s)
--- PASS: TestAccS3BucketPolicy_IAMRoleOrder_policyDocNotPrincipal (198.54s)
--- PASS: TestAccS3Bucket_Basic_basic (71.43s)
--- PASS: TestAccS3BucketInventory_encryptWithSSEKMS (65.51s)
--- PASS: TestAccS3Bucket_Basic_namePrefix (71.10s)
--- PASS: TestAccS3Bucket_Security_grantToACL (115.20s)
--- PASS: TestAccS3Bucket_Basic_acceleration (126.33s)
--- PASS: TestAccS3BucketMetric_withEmptyFilter (1.44s)
--- PASS: TestAccS3BucketDataSource_website (54.09s)
--- PASS: TestAccS3BucketInventory_basic (52.80s)
--- PASS: TestAccS3BucketAnalyticsConfiguration_updateBasic (174.91s)
--- PASS: TestAccS3BucketIntelligentTieringConfiguration_basic (49.70s)
--- PASS: TestAccS3Bucket_Security_policy (180.56s)
--- PASS: TestAccS3BucketMetric_withFilterSingleTag (91.99s)
--- PASS: TestAccS3BucketMetric_withFilterMultipleTags (87.65s)
--- PASS: TestAccS3Bucket_Security_updateGrant (175.79s)
--- PASS: TestAccS3BucketMetric_basic (46.02s)
--- PASS: TestAccS3BucketMetric_withFilterPrefixAndMultipleTags (84.14s)
--- PASS: TestAccS3BucketDataSource_basic (44.70s)
--- PASS: TestAccS3BucketMetric_withFilterPrefixAndSingleTag (86.98s)
--- PASS: TestAccS3Bucket_Tags_withNoSystemTags (224.71s)
--- PASS: TestAccS3BucketMetric_withFilterPrefix (75.21s)
--- PASS: TestAccS3BucketPolicy_IAMRoleOrder_jsonEncode (287.54s)
--- PASS: TestAccS3Bucket_Security_updateACL (91.23s)
--- PASS: TestAccS3BucketInventory_encryptWithSSES3 (37.72s)
--- PASS: TestAccS3Bucket_Tags_withSystemTags (252.52s)
--- PASS: TestAccS3BucketIntelligentTieringConfiguration_Filter (139.54s)
--- PASS: TestAccS3BucketReplicationConfiguration_withoutPrefix (326.07s)
--- PASS: TestAccS3BucketReplicationConfiguration_filter_tagFilter (320.94s)
--- PASS: TestAccS3BucketReplicationConfiguration_filter_andOperator (374.99s)
PASS
ok github.com/hashicorp/terraform-provider-aws/internal/service/s3 1030.676s
ac0cd8c
to
d0017bc
Compare
d0017bc
to
65ae041
Compare
65ae041
to
f659a15
Compare
Output of additional tests changed:
|
b44f112
to
6c0584d
Compare
This functionality has been released in v4.0.0 of the Terraform AWS Provider. Please see the Terraform documentation on provider versioning or reach out if you need any assistance upgrading. For further feature requests or bug reports with this functionality, please create a new GitHub issue following the template. Thank you! |
I'm going to lock this pull request because it has been closed for 30 days ⏳. This helps our maintainers find and focus on the active issues. |
Community Note
Relates #4418
Relates #20433
Output from acceptance testing: